What game does Ezio meet Altair?

Assassin's Creed Revelations originally launched in 2011 on Xbox 360, PlayStation 3, and PC. The game brought together the franchise's two lead characters up to that point, Altair from the original Assassin's Creed and Ezio from Assassin's Creed II and Brotherhood.

Did assassins like Assassins Creed exist?

Were the Assassins real? They were, sort of. The legends are based on the Nizari Ismailis—a breakaway group from the Ismaili branch of Shia Islam—that occupied a string of mountain castles in Syria and Iran from the end of the 11th century until the Mongol conquests in the middle of the 13th.

Who is the oldest assassin in Assassins Creed?

The first protagonist introduced in the Assassin's Creed franchise, Altair Ibn La Ahad, is an Assassin present during the third crusade. Born in Masyaf on January 11, 1165, he was around 26-years-old during the first game. By the time of his death, he was aged 92.

What type of assassin is Altaïr?

Altaïr Ibn-La'Ahad is the main protagonist of Assassin's Creed, as well as a minor protagonist in Assassin's Creed II, and the deuteragonist in Assassin's Creed: Revelations. He was a Syrian Assassin during the Middle Ages and, from 1191 until his death, the Mentor of the Assassins in the Levant.

What is the shortest Assassin's Creed game?

17 Assassin's Creed Freedom Cry - 4.5 Hours

The game is the shortest in the series because it was originally scheduled to be DLC for Assassin's Creed IV: Black Flag, but with a unique protagonist, Ubisoft and gamers agreed that, though short, it deserved to be its own game.
